First Ukrainian International Bank (FUIB) has been recognized as a bank with one of the highest levels of data compliance according to the Data Integrity Compliance Program annual monitoring carried out by the MasterCard international payment system. According to the results of this study, the Processing Center of FUIB received an award for the high level of clearing and authorization data compliance in the Europe region.

"The task of FUIB as a bank is to ensure the reliability, security and convenience of work for our partners. The fact that FUIB was included in the group of leading European processing centers is the best confirmation of the high quality of services provided by our processing center," noted Tomasz Wiszniewski, FUIB's operating officer and Deputy Chairman of the Board. 

Monitoring, which MasterCard has been carrying out since 2013, is aimed at confirming high standards of quality and efficiency of transaction processing on the part of bank processing centers, and at minimizing the risks of transactions protesting, as well as at improving the level of payment card services.
